2023年生物乙酸市值為2.8423億美元,預計2024年將達到3.0333億美元,複合年成長率為7.14%,到2030年將達到4.6065億美元。

可再生生物來源生物乙酸作為石化燃料乙酸的永續替代品,滿足了對環保解決方案不斷成長的需求。此生物產品以食品和飲料、紡織和化學工業為主要市場,可作為防腐劑和酸度調節劑,具有廣泛的應用前景。由於嚴格的環境法規和消費者轉向生物基產品的推動,人們越來越重視綠色化學和永續性,對該市場的需求正在增加。因此,最終用途範圍從生物分解性聚合物到農藥,以及黏劑、油墨和綠色溶劑生產的應用。推動成長的關鍵因素包括政府加強對生物基產品的支持、生物技術的進步以及尋求減少碳排放的最終用戶產業不斷成長的需求。最近的商機在於開發具有成本效益的生產方法,並得到產學界合作進行先進研發活動的支持。公司有機會透過投資創新生產技術來利用這些機會,以提高產量比率並降低成本。然而,該市場面臨一些挑戰,例如與合成替代品相比生產成本較高、生物原料價格波動以及實現有競爭力的價格的技術障礙。解決這些限制需要關注製程效率和規模,並推進微生物發酵製程和基因工程的研究以最佳化生產。混合生物技術製程的創新和新原料來源的探索可以提供突破性機會。這個市場競爭非常激烈,老牌公司和優先研究和開發新應用程式的新興企業都做出了巨大貢獻。隨著永續性變得越來越重要,公司可以透過提高透明度和永續性來獲得競爭優勢,使其成為循環經濟的重要方面。

The Bio-acetic Acid Market was valued at USD 284.23 million in 2023, expected to reach USD 303.33 million in 2024, and is projected to grow at a CAGR of 7.14%, to USD 460.65 million by 2030.

Bio-acetic acid, derived from renewable biological sources, serves as a sustainable alternative to fossil-fuel-derived acetic acid, aligning with the rising demand for eco-friendly solutions. With its primary markets in food and beverages, textiles, and chemical industries, this bioproduct acts as a preservative and acidity regulator, thereby demonstrating wide-reaching applications. The market draws necessity from the growing emphasis on green chemistry and sustainability, propelled by stringent environmental regulations and a consumer shift towards bio-based products. Consequently, its end-use scope is vast, from biodegradable polymers to agricultural chemicals, with applications in the manufacture of adhesives, inks, and green solvents. Key factors driving growth include increasing governmental support for bio-based products, advancements in biotechnology, and the escalating demand from end-user industries aiming to reduce their carbon footprint. Recent opportunities lie in developing cost-effective production methods, supported by collaborations between academia and industry for advanced research and development activities. Companies have the chance to capitalize on these opportunities by investing in innovative production technologies to enhance yield and reduce costs. However, the market confronts challenges such as higher production costs compared to synthetic alternatives, fluctuating prices of bio-feedstocks, and technological barriers in achieving competitive pricing. Addressing these limitations requires emphasizing process efficiency and scale, stimulating ongoing research in microbial fermentation processes and genetic engineering to optimize production. Innovating hybrid biotechnological processes and exploring new raw material sources could offer groundbreaking opportunities. The market is intensely competitive, with significant contributions from both established firms and emerging startups prioritizing R&D for novel applications. As sustainability becomes more pivotal, businesses can gain a competitive edge by promoting transparency and lifecycle sustainability in their bio-acetic acid offerings, making it an essential aspect of the circular economy.

Market Dynamics: Unveiling Key Market Insights in the Rapidly Evolving Bio-acetic Acid Market

The Bio-acetic Acid Market is undergoing transformative changes driven by a dynamic interplay of supply and demand factors. Understanding these evolving market dynamics prepares business organizations to make informed investment decisions, refine strategic decisions, and seize new opportunities. By gaining a comprehensive view of these trends, business organizations can mitigate various risks across political, geographic, technical, social, and economic domains while also gaining a clearer understanding of consumer behavior and its impact on manufacturing costs and purchasing trends.

  • Market Drivers
    • Concerns associated with environmental and health impacts of synthetic acetic acid
    • Growing use of bio-acetic acid to manufacture of photographic films and textiles
    • Rising investments in construction industry and need for advanced coatings
  • Market Restraints
    • Price volatility of organic materials for bioacetic acid making
  • Market Opportunities
    • Emerging use of genetic engineering techniques for acetic acid bioproduction
    • Improved expansion of bio-acetic acid with sustainability certifications
  • Market Challenges
    • Complexities associated with manufacturing of bio-based acetic acid
